Kagara’s Abducted School Children, Others Reportedly Regain Freedom

Information available to BIGPENNGR.COM indicates that 27 abducted Students of Governments Science College Kagara in Rafi local government area of Niger state have regained their freedom.

This medium reports that the victims were released five days after they were kidnapped by gunmen from their school.

Released alongside the school children were three staff of the school and their 12 family members.

The development is coming few days after the intervention of Kaduna based Islamic Cleric, Sheik Ahmed Gumi who on Thursday last week visited the bandits hideout in Niger state.

The Cleric who also met with the state governor, Alhaji Abubakar Sani Bello at the government house in Minna, gave the assurance that all the abductees will be released today (Sunday).

No official statement from the government or the police as of the time of filing this report Sunday night but a security source who confirmed the released said that all the victims are said to be in good condition and may have be ferried back to Minna, the state capital.
